Repair of windows made of upvc: Cost

The type of windows you choose and the work required will determine the cost of upvc window repairs near me. Repairs to double pane windows are generally more expensive than repairs to upvc windows of single-pane windows.

You might need to replace the seals of your window and hinges. Broken window springs can cause the sash to become stuck when you open the window. A damaged lock or handle can also render your window vulnerable to burglars.

Windows could require to be repaired for a variety of reasons. Broken glass, faulty hinges or loose hinges are just some of the reasons your windows require repair. Other reasons are leaky seals or a malfunctioning balance or spring.

If you're looking for a low-cost way to fix your window, a DIY upvc window repair can be the answer. But before you get started you should know what you'll pay on the repairs.

It's cheaper to replace just a single pane of glass than to replace a whole window according to the majority of homeowners. You can save hundreds of dollars by repairing your window rather than replacing it.

However the cost of replacing a damaged frame can be quite expensive. They can be expensive due to the rot that may develop if the wood is exposed to humidity. If you decide to replace the frame, you will be required to remove all the rotten sections and replace them with new wood.

Depending on the size and condition of your windows, you should expect to spend between $75-$300 for them to be repaired. It is important to remember that you'll require two people to repair your windows. If you have more than one window you will save money.

If you need to replace your window screen, you'll need to buy the screen itself. Prices for screens vary depending on the thickness of the screen and the type of material. Screen replacements range from $150 and $350.
